Cilic to meet Melzer in Vienna final


Last Update: 10/31 1:45 pm

Top-seeded Marin Cilic moved past fourth- seeded Philipp Kohlschreiber and into Sunday's final at the Bank Austria Tennis Trophy.

Cilic downed Kohlschreiber 6-4, 7-6 (7-4) to join seventh-seeded Jurgen Melzer, who rallied past Serb Janko Tipsarevic 4-6, 7-6 (7-5), 6-4.

Melzer owns his only title at a clay-court tournament in Bucharest three years ago. The crown favorite became the first Austrian to reach the final here since Thomas Muster in 1995. He will try to become the first Austrian winner here since Horst Skoff in 1988.

The top-seeded Cilic is in his way. The 13th-ranked player in the world won way back in January at the Chennai Open then took a title during the first week of February at the PBZ Zagreb Indoors.
